STATEMENT OF CASE
This
matter came before the Utah State Tax Commission for an Initial Hearing
pursuant to the provisions of Utah Code Ann. §59-1-502.5, on XXXXX. Gail S. Reich, Administrative Law Judge,
heard the matter for and on behalf of the Commission. Present and representing Petitioner was XXXXX, Tax Manager.
Present and representing Respondent was XXXXX of the Collection Division.
This
Appeal involves a request for waiver of penalty and interest for XXXXX
withholding taxes. Petitioner became a
business entity in XXXXX. However, an
inordinate amount of time transpired before there was a filing for an account
number. Therefore, the payments were
being applied to a different entity under same ownership. Some of the confusion appears to be as a
result of information given by the Tax Commission regarding the issue of
whether payments were made on a monthly or quarterly basis. However, the underlying problem resulted
from the failure to timely file for an account number by Petitioner.
Based
upon the foregoing, the Respondent has recommended that the penalty but not the
interest be waived.
APPLICABLE LAW
The
Tax Commission is granted the authority to waive, reduce, or compromise
penalties and interest upon a showing of reasonable cause. (Utah Code Ann. §59-1-401(10).)
DECISION AND ORDER
Based
upon the information presented at the hearing, and the records of the Tax
Commission, the Commission finds sufficient cause has been shown to waive the
penalties but not the interest assessed for XXXXX withholding tax.
